This is the long format episode that chronicles my 32 day, 2300 nm passage from Los Angeles to Honolulu onboard my 1965 Alberg 30 sailboat SV TRITEIA.
1000 miles from Hawaii my rudder failed due to striking a submerged object (that was painted red). After failed attempts to secure the control lines to the rudder due to large seas and high winds I was forced to steer with a small "Sea Squid" drogue for 18 days.
Triteia is equipped with a vintage Sailomat Aux Rudder wind vane which helped a great deal but was far undersized compared to the large rudder attached to Triteia’s full keel. The Windvane started to fail internally soon after the rudder failure. I was able to make a makeshift tiller handle that allowed me to turn the boat to get it back on course but the self steering started popping out of gear and stopped working completely while I crossed the channel between Molokai and Oahu forcing me to sit on the transom and hand steer for the last 6 hours of this intense passage.

@@TechCrawl When it comes to boats, yes. Boats don't just get longer, they get larger in every dimension. In a lot of ways it's an exponential difference. A boat that's twice as long is easily 3 to 4 times as massive. A 20-ft day sailer weighs a few thousand pounds and can be towed behind your pickup truck... A 38 ft blue water cruiser might weigh 20 tons. The difference between a 24 and a 30 ft boat is actually rather dramatic.
